About this episode
The episode discusses the creation of pollinator gardens at camps across the U.S. that incorporate outdoor musical instruments to enhance connection with nature and promote wellbeing.
Discover how camps across the U.S. are transforming outdoor spaces into vibrant pollinator gardens filled with music. In this CampFest webinar, Percussion Play explores how nature-inspired outdoor musical instruments invite campers to slow down, connect with the environment, and create music together. Learn how these multi-sensory spaces support wellbeing, environmental education, and inclusive play—while buzzing with bees, butterflies, and rhythm. Presenters are Alex Cook, Camp Specialist...
